Unreal Tournament 4 didn't get a chance to fail because it was never a real release. UT4 was a free tech demo for Unreal Engine 4 that never got completed because Fortnite started taking off at that time and developers were deallocated from it.

And UT3 was definitely not a great game by anyone's measure.

It was never officially released, but it was on the front page of epic launcher for years, even after fortnite took off. The online experience was fairly complete and enjoyable (for people with experience) for ctf, duel, tdm, and team arena master. But yeah, epic didn't support it as much as they could have.
